    What kinds of bedknives have y'all found most effective. I mow two greens having contours with walk behind every day. JD tournament, standard, or extra thin. I cut with the standard bedknives right now. My HOC is steadily .125-.135 range on Miniverde. What bedknives have you found most effective. Or what's the comparison?

    Are you using a fixed or floating head mower? I always used JRM 114's, their micro thin extened knife and had great results. I have also had the dealers recommend JRM to me as well. The JD knife sits a little farther back from the center line creating a more aggrissive cut. Try the JRM's and see if you like the results, I have been very happy with their quality, and the results of running them on Deere equipment.
